“…Recently, Thalmann et al identified Sc1 from mouse otoconia by mass spectrometry ). However, Xu et al (Xu et al 2010) found that Sc1 was hardly detectable in the wild-type otoconia. Instead, the deposition of Sc1 was drastically increased in otoconia crystals when Oc90 is absent, suggesting a possible role for Sc1 as an alternative process of biomineralization (Xu et al 2010).…”
